Initial Steps in Chocolate Making

  • The cacao arrives in bags as raw beans primarily sourced from Tabasco and Chiapas, Mexico.
  • The factory has been producing chocolate since 1896 and emphasizes sanitation with specific rules for visitors.

Processing Cacao Beans

Fermentation and Roasting

  • Cacao beans undergo fermentation to develop color, flavor, and aroma; roasting further enhances these qualities.
  • The roasting process is crucial for removing moisture and achieving desired flavor profiles.

Shell Removal and Grinding

  • After roasting, the outer shell of the cacao bean is removed to obtain the nib or granilla used for further processing.
  • The grinding process produces cocoa mass or liquor, which is essential for making chocolate.

Extracting Cocoa Butter

Pressing Cacao Liquor

  • The cacao liquor is pressed to separate solid cocoa cake from cocoa butter; both are vital ingredients in chocolate production.
  • Regulations dictate specific ratios of cocoa butter and liquor required to label a product as "chocolate."

Creating Different Types of Chocolate

Mixing Ingredients

  • To create various types of chocolate (dark, milk, white), different proportions of sugar, milk powder, and cocoa butter are mixed.
  • Refining improves texture by ensuring that all components blend smoothly without graininess.

Conching Process

  • Conching involves mixing chocolate at controlled temperatures for 24–48 hours to enhance creaminess and reduce moisture content.

Finalizing Chocolate Products

Tempering and Molding

  • Tempering stabilizes cocoa butter crystals ensuring that finished chocolates have a glossy finish and snap when broken.
  • Automated machines control dosages during molding while maintaining proper temperature settings throughout the process.

Filling Chocolates

  • Once molded into shells (coquillas), chocolates can be filled with various fillings like liqueurs or creams before sealing them with additional layers of chocolate.

Packaging and Artisan Techniques

Individual Wrapping Process

  • Finished chocolates are wrapped individually using automated machines designed for efficiency while maintaining quality standards.

Traditional Methods

  • Artisanal techniques are still employed in some products like hojuelas where workers manually temper chocolate before shaping it.
